About Me
I am committed to supporting teens, young adults, and adults (16yrs+) learn how to build
healthier relationships with themselves and others. My work focuses on coping with anxiety,
depression, complex grief, and healing from trauma in sustainable ways.
​
I believe in taking a collaborative approach to helping clients reach their goals. My approaches
are person-centered, strengths based, relational, and systems oriented. I invite the whole
person to step into judgement-free vulnerability, and I offer support with identifying and
building shame resilience. I thoroughly believe that no matter the maladaptive behaviors and
emotional responses individuals endorse, they are completely understandable in the context of
simply being human with abnormal life experiences in an abnormal system.
​
I am passionate about creating a welcoming, trusting, and safe environment for those who wish
to target ineffective behaviors, habits, and beliefs. I strive to assist others in living their most
authentic, meaningful life by encouraging self-love and compassion. I offer support with finding
stability through nervous system regulation and somatic mind-body thriving. I practice from a
psychodynamic perspective and utilize various therapeutic modalities such as Cognitive
Behavior Therapy and Dialectical Behavior Therapy. I also have training in Narrative Exposure
Therapy and use creative, expressive arts in order to cultivate deeper meaning-making and
posttraumatic growth from the inside out.
​
I hold lived experience as a motherless daughter and interpersonal violence survivor, which aid
in my strong passion and desire to give back to this work. I understand how difficult it is to ask
for help and take the first step into therapy. I am here to remind you of your capabilities with
care, warmth, and encouragement. My clients are the drivers of their experiences, and I am
along for the ride if you would like me to be.
